# US-001: Opt into Leaf protection
|
||||
|
||||
As a **player**, I want to opt into Leaf protection so that I can receive a modest defensive boost while playing on a hard server.
|
||||
|
||||
## Acceptance criteria
|
||||
|
||||
- [ ] Players with the `leaf.use` permission, granted by default, can use `/leaf on`, `/leaf off`, and `/leaf status`.
|
||||
- [ ] `/leaf on` records the player's opt-in choice and grants Resistance I while Leaf is globally enabled.
|
||||
- [ ] Resistance remains continuously effective without distracting expiry or renewal messages or particles.
|
||||
- [ ] `/leaf off` records the player's opt-out choice and immediately removes only the Resistance effect managed by Leaf.
|
||||
- [ ] `/leaf status` clearly distinguishes the player's saved choice, active protection, administrative lock, and global Leaf state.
|
||||
- [ ] Repeating an already-satisfied `on` or `off` command is safe and explains that no change was needed.
|
||||
- [ ] Opt-in choices are keyed by UUID and survive logout and server restart.
|
||||
- [ ] A player who joins while opted in regains protection when Leaf is enabled.
|
||||
- [ ] Player-command autocomplete suggests only valid next arguments available to the sender.
